House Foundation Leveling in Tampa, FL
House foundation leveling services address uneven or settling foundations that can cause structural issues in residential properties. These services typically involve assessing the foundation’s condition, identifying areas of sinking or shifting, and then using specialized techniques such as mudjacking or piering to restore the foundation to its proper level. Projects often include correcting uneven floors, cracks in walls, or gaps around windows and doors, helping to improve the stability and safety of the home.
Homeowners considering foundation leveling usually want to understand the causes of uneven settling, the methods used to level the foundation, and how the process may impact their property. It’s important to evaluate the extent of the foundation’s movement and any underlying soil conditions before proceeding. Proper assessment and planning can help ensure that the work effectively stabilizes the structure and prevents future issues.

House Foundation Leveling Questions
What causes foundation settling? Foundation settling can result from soil movement, moisture changes, or poor initial construction, leading to uneven support under a home.
How can leveling improve a property? Leveling can correct uneven floors, prevent further damage, and help maintain the structural integrity of a home.
What types of foundation issues are addressed? Common issues include cracks, uneven floors, and sinking sections that affect the stability of the structure.
Is foundation leveling suitable for all homes? It is typically suitable for homes experiencing uneven settling or minor shifts, but an assessment can determine the best approach.
